Intergas Boiler – Error Code 2

Intergas Error Code 2: The Intergas Boiler’s Error Code 2 means that the sensors S1 and S2 have been switched or interchanged. This means that the sensor that is supposed to be in position S1 is actually in position S2, and vice versa. This can cause the boiler to not function properly because it relies on the sensors to measure and regulate temperature. To fix this error, the sensors need to be correctly placed in their designated positions.

Recommended solution/fix steps

If you see Error Code 2 on your Intergas Boiler, it means that the sensors S1 and S2 have been interchanged. The next steps to take would be to switch off the boiler and disconnect it from the power supply. Then, you should check the wiring and ensure that the sensors are connected to the correct terminals. If the wiring is correct, you may need to replace one or both of the sensors. Once the issue has been resolved, you can switch the boiler back on and check that it is functioning correctly. If you are unsure about any of these steps, it is recommended that you contact a qualified heating engineer for assistance.

Can I still use my Intergas boiler?

After seeing Error Code 2 on the Intergas Boiler, which indicates that the sensors S1 and S2 have been interchanged, it is not recommended to continue operating the machine. This error suggests that there is a problem with the sensors, specifically that they have been incorrectly connected. Operating the boiler in this state could potentially lead to further issues or damage. It is important to address this error promptly and have a professional technician correct the sensor connections before attempting to use the machine again. Ignoring this error and continuing to operate the boiler could result in inefficient performance, potential safety hazards, or even complete system failure.
